Population Overview

Point Pleasant Beach is a small community located in New Jersey, within Ocean County. The total population is 4,855. It ranks as the 308th most populous out of 700 Census-designated places in New Jersey.

Age Demographics

The median age in Point Pleasant Beach is 48.5 years. This is 21% higher than the state median of 40.1 years.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Point Pleasant Beach is $141,716. This is 37% higher than the state median of $103,556. It is also 76% higher than the national median of $80,734. The poverty rate stands at 5.2%. This is 46% lower than the state poverty rate of 9.7%. The unemployment rate is 5.6%. This is 12% lower than the state rate of 6.3%. The median home value is $850,300. Housing costs are 87% higher than the state median of $454,400. The home-value-to-income ratio is 6.0x. 75.8%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 19% higher than the state average of 63.8%.

Race & Ethnicity

The largest racial or ethnic group in Point Pleasant Beach is White (non-Hispanic), making up 83.0% of the population.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 12.8%. The White (non-Hispanic) population is significantly higher than the state average (83.0% vs 50.9%). The Black or African American population (0.8%) is well below the state average of 12.2%. The Asian population (1.5%) is well below the state average of 10.1%.

Education

59.6%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 37% higher than the state rate of 43.6%. Nationally, 35.7%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 92.4%. Notably, 17.9% of adults hold a graduate or professional degree, indicating a highly educated workforce.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Point Pleasant Beach, New Jersey is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 2020–2024 5-Year Estimates. The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ually and pools five years of responses so that even small communities can be measured, though the margin of error widens as the population falls. Comparisons are made against New Jersey state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 700 Census-designated places in New Jersey.
